Specifications
DC Resistance (DCR): 7.2 Ohm
Height - Seated (Max): 0.650" (16.50mm)
Size / Dimension: 0.492" Dia (12.50mm)
Supplier Device Package: --
Package / Case: Radial
Mounting Type: Through Hole
Inductance Frequency - Test: 10kHz
Operating Temperature: --
Ratings: --
Frequency - Self Resonant: --
Q @ Freq: --
Series: 12D
Shielding: Unshielded
Current - Saturation: --
Current Rating: 270mA
Tolerance: ±10%
Inductance: 10mH
Material - Core: --
Type: Wirewound
Part Status: Active
Packaging: Bulk
